Output 77aac90d9e20d209d6713b76c82c4a194a51bf3648e5d23b0728520590c5f49e:0

value
3098242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 146ce32b9f4da872296ee1839062652fc3609e47 OP_EQUAL
address
33Z1t1SirYijWPxXPZCxkY8p7MN1qfdnr6
transaction
77aac90d9e20d209d6713b76c82c4a194a51bf3648e5d23b0728520590c5f49e
confirmations
289370
spent
true